CRES 811 Methods of Motion Analysis

This course teaches the fundamental components of movement analysis, such as three-dimensional motion capture, force measurement, and electromyography will be covered. Participants will understand how motion capture works using infrared cameras, accelerometers, and pressure sensors. The collection and processing of surface EMG data will also be covered. At this end of this course, participants will understand what type of data is produced and integrated from these systems and how data from these instruments can be processed for analysis.

Student Learning Outcomes

  1. 1. Set up and interact with the following instrumentation- i. Passive infrared 3D motion capture
  2. 2. Markerless based 3D motion capture (we have Qualisys, Theia, and develop our own markerless based solutions in Python)
  3. 3. 2D motion capture (we have Kinovea)
  4. 4. 3D force plates (we have Bertec)
  5. 5. Surface electromyography and inertial measurement units (we have Delsys)
  6. 6. Instrumented treadmills (split belt Bertec force instrumented in Sioux Falls and single belt Zebris pressure instrumented in Fargo)
  7. 7. Instron material testing system
